Default The GAUNTLET [3.5 Tournament Style Dungeon Speed Run] (Always Recruiting)

Ladies and Gentlmen, Boys and Girls, And the millions of fans watching on Cabalvision. Can these competators take on...
The GAUNTLET!

The GAUNTLET is an Arena-style Challenge where Speed is what separates the champions from the survivors, And surviving separate the winners from the losers.


Once your character is created, head to the Green Room to familiarize yourself with the rules, ask any questions, and say something to your adoring fans.

General Information
  • This is D&D 3.5.
  • This is competition is a Quick Paced dungeon run. You get from Point A to Point B as quickly as you can, defeating all challenges in your way.
  • It takes place right here, right now: The OotS Forums!
  • We'll always be recruiting.

Character Creation Information
  • The Encounters are the same for everyone, but each character beyond the first faces a new set of encounters.
  • All characters start at first level; zero experience.
  • Starting gold is the maximum possible for a character of your class.
    Spoiler
  • Gear can be purchased from any non-banned source. This includes magic items from the DMG or other source books, so you may start with Potions of Cure Light Wounds or other gear.
  • A special note: All the mundane clothing outfits found in the PHB or SRD, excepting the Cold Weather Outfit, are free, so you can dress your character however you wish. You are not required to have your character wear clothing of any sort, but it is recomended.
  • Characters may not purchase any mounts, attack animals, mercenaries, undead, with the exception of a single mount. Possesion of more than one mount is prohibited. (Note: You can't open a door while mounted on a large creature)
  • Characters of any class will be accepted, as long as it is official WotC material from a non-banned 3.5 D&D source.
  • Any race with no more than a +1 level adjustment is allowed. Races with a level adjustment must work out a racial class with any referee.
    Spoiler
  • Characters may not be of a race that has any racial hit dice.
  • Characters may not have any template applied to them, with the exception of the Dragonborn template, from Races of the Dragon. (You must spend your wealth to gain this template, and again at each level, as with spells added to your spellbook)
  • Ability scores will be generated using a 32-point point buy.
  • Hit points are maximized for first level, and averaged as given in the DMG forevermore afterwards.
  • Alignment doesn't really matter, except in the cases of alignment-based spells and items, such as paladin spells or a Protection From _____ spell.
  • Paladins,Clerics, and other characters with alignment-based codes of conduct are not required to uphold those restrictions to keep their abilities. For example, a Paladin can use poison without losing his powers, but a Knight must continue to operate under the restrictions of the Knight's Code (as they are not alignment based).
  • Multiclassing XP penalties are removed, for ease of bookkeeping. Otherwise, multiclassing is as normal.
  • All die rolling must be made with the in-forum roller.
  • No, you don't have to write a backstory. And IC stuff is not required...but it does make it a bit more fun if you play along.
  • Only material from rulebooks you can access can be used, to prevent confusion about the rules.
